I spoke with my dealer today about the issue of the warranty. Acording to him its up to the discretion of the dealer wether or not to cover warenty issues. In other words If I chose to do the maintnace myself there is not a problem keeping the warranty in check, on the other hand if I put the cams in wrong and bend all the valves and its obviosly my falt its my problem.

Good news is NO KTM cannot force you to have them do routine maintance to keep the warranty in good standings.

Or at least thats how I understand it at this point
